Output 2e6515308f00c58e07e26faf414555a78fe116409a58ec11d5963fcbef488280:14

value
4200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c63bb4cc9a49aad1855edaa2b6fbd980fe1007 OP_EQUAL
address
3NTNnaKorRfVETAja59ANcTzogMuRLXtvP
transaction
2e6515308f00c58e07e26faf414555a78fe116409a58ec11d5963fcbef488280
confirmations
217041
spent
true